We are currently hiring for Automation Engineer for our new Concord, NC site!

Responsibilities
  • Provide automation design and oversight to the delivery of Lilly's new Concord facility. Manage system integrators to deliver all aspects of Automation for Lilly's new Concord based facility. Support key corporate initiatives such as life cycle management, Engineering information management, and cyber security. Drive automation governance and replication across the Global Parenteral Network and the Global Packaging Network for Tier 1 equipment, architecture, and Automation/IT systems and solutions.
  • Safety – Work safely and continually look for improvements in personnel and equipment safety, ensure safe design and operation of new equipment, ensure automation design reflects safety concerns for operations and maintenance.
  • Automation/Control Discipline and Technical Leadership – Partner with colleagues to lead the discipline through solution assessment, replication, and development. Manage tools, engineering standards, master specifications and best practices. Provide technical coaching and consultation to other Lilly engineers, facilitate shared learning forums.
  • Automation Design – Provide support to European manufacturing sites and Global Facilities Delivery during project profiling and design. Ensure project design meets intended requirements, considers life‑cycle cost, and eliminates non‑value‑add complexity. Use replication and best practices to optimize project cost.
  • External Influence and Benchmarking – Monitor and influence, when appropriate, changes in external codes and standards on Lilly’s behalf, and work to ensure ongoing compliance within Lilly. Extract benchmarking information from academia and industry.
  • Technology and Innovation – Keep current on external trends and practices to evaluate technology for application within Lilly.
  • Evaluate new technology and innovation trends leading to the development of proof of concepts and sharing of use cases for application within Lilly.
  • Drive automation governance and replication across the Global Parenteral Network and the Global Packaging Network for Tier 1 equipment, architecture, and Automation/IT systems and solutions.
  • Work to optimizes and improve project automation engineering approaches by combining technical expertise, best practices, engineering standards, and project delivery expertise.
Basic Qualifications
  • Bachelor's Degree in Engineering, Computer Technology, or a related field
  • Minimum 3 years’ experience in automation machine control, process control, or equivalent work experience in a related field
  • Qualified applicants must be authorized to work in the United States on a full‑time basis. Lilly will not provide support for or sponsor work authorization or visas for this role, including but not limited to F‑1 CPT, F‑1 OPT, F‑1 STEM OPT, J‑1, H‑1B, TN, O‑1, E‑3, H‑1B1, or L‑1
Preferred Skills/Experience
  • Demonstrated ability to work safely
  • Demonstrated expertise in one or more automation platforms, preferable Rockwell Automation Systems.
  • Demonstrated expertise with Rockwell Factory Talk Batch software.
  • Demonstrated expertise in robotic and conveyor systems preferably FANUC and/or Staubli Robots.
  • Significant experience and strong problem‑solving skills in measurements, control (process and/or manufacturing), control systems, integration, and data.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to manage people and projects to deliver a common set of objectives
  • Knowledge of GMP’s and pharmaceutical manufacturing
  • Knowledge in Microsoft Operating Systems
  • Knowledge in Databases
Additional Information
  • Expectation that the position will be based out of Concord, North Carolina
  • Monday through Friday, and some weekend/holiday may be required for project support.
  • Travel:
    Domestic and International travel may be required, up to 25% during site start‑up
